--- C:/Users/Onno/Documents/Temp/JvDSADialogs_old.pas	Sat May 30 00:39:26 2009
+++ C:/Users/Onno/Documents/Temp/JvDSADialogs.pas	Sat May 30 00:34:28 2009
@@ -802,10 +802,11 @@
       VertMargin := MulDiv(mcVertMargin, DialogUnits.Y, 8);
       HorzSpacing := MulDiv(mcHorzSpacing, DialogUnits.X, 4);
       VertSpacing := MulDiv(mcVertSpacing, DialogUnits.Y, 8);
       ButtonWidth := MulDiv(mcButtonWidth, DialogUnits.X, 4);
       Timeout := Abs(ATimeout);
+      HelpContext := HelpCtx;
       for I := Low(Buttons) to High(Buttons) do
       begin
         TextRect := Rect(0, 0, 0, 0);
         {Windows.}DrawText(Canvas.Handle, PChar(Buttons[I]), -1, TextRect,
           DT_CALCRECT or DT_LEFT or DT_SINGLELINE or DrawTextBiDiModeFlagsReadingOnly);
